Today’s weather, 28 August: Rivers in Punjab in spate due to heavy rains
Due to the rains in Punjab for the past several days, the rivers here are in spate. Due to the rains, the flood situation in Kapurthala district has become more serious. Whereas in Ferozepur, people have started evacuating the villages situated on the banks of the river areas. Due to the release of excess water from Pong and Bhakra dams and heavy rains, the water level of seasonal rivers and streams including Sutlej, Beas and Ravi rivers has increased rapidly.
Today’s weather, 28 August: Snowfall in Ladakh
The high altitude areas of the Union Territory of Ladakh witnessed the first snowfall of the season. While its lower areas received moderate rainfall. According to the IMD, there is a possibility of rain at many places in the next 24 to 48 hours. Meteorologists have issued a ‘red alert’ for Ladakh.
